Egyptian leader who laid the foundation for modern Egypt

History
1 answer:
IrinaK [193]3 years ago
7 0
The founder of modern egypt is Muhammad Ali

What did the glass-steagall act of 1932 accomplish?.
Lana71 [14]
The Glass-Steagall Act effectively separated commercial banking from investment banking and created the Federal Deposit Insurance Corporation, among other things
